Съдържание:

Ардуино състезателен симулатор и кабина: 3 стъпки
Ардуино състезателен симулатор и кабина: 3 стъпки

Видео: Ардуино състезателен симулатор и кабина: 3 стъпки

Видео: Ардуино състезателен симулатор и кабина: 3 стъпки
Видео: DIY home FlightSim setup with 12 Arduino boards. Сделал кабину для симулятора дома! Cockpit v3 (pv3) 2024, Ноември
Anonim
Ардуино състезателен симулатор и кабина
Ардуино състезателен симулатор и кабина
Ардуино състезателен симулатор и кабина
Ардуино състезателен симулатор и кабина

В тази инструкция ще ви покажа как създадох напълно ардуино контролиран VR състезателен симулатор с мощно колело за обратна сила, 6 -степенна скоростна кутия и алуминиева стойка за педали. Рамката ще бъде изработена от PVC и MDF. Целта ми за този проект беше да създам състезателно изживяване, което се чувства изключително реално във VR. Не се притеснявах как изглежда симулаторът, а само как се чувства, когато VR очилата са включени. Исках също да направя това бюджетен проект и всички материали, включително VR очилата, ми струват по -малко от 350 долара от местен магазин за хардуер и Amazon. Имайте предвид, че неговият проект не е завършен, тъй като това е текущ проект и ще актуализирам този Instructable често, но започвам сега, тъй като този проект е моят основен камък в моя гимназиален клас STEM.

Консумативи

Материали за този проект могат лесно да бъдат закупени от онлайн търговци на дребно и големи магазини за хардуер. Като се има предвид това, няма да предоставя пълен списък с пвц компоненти или пвц размери, тъй като този симулатор е създаден с конкретен стил на автомобила и също така е създаден с ограничения на размера, за да се побере в стаята, която избрах да го поставя. Има много различни неща, които трябва да се вземат предвид при проектирането на рамката, като стил на автомобил, (GT Car, Drift Car, Time Attack, Formula 1 и други класове Open Cockpit …). За Моя дизайн избрах да подражавам на позицията и оформлението на шофьорите на дрифт/Time Attack. Сега към материалите.

Необходими материали:

Прибл. 40 фута 1,5 инча PVC

Прибл. 12 1.5in 90 -градусови лакти от PVC

Прибл. 25 1,5-инчови PVC фитинги от PVC

3/4 MDF лист

100 опаковки винтове за ламарина #10 с дължина 1 инча

100 пакета #10 винтове за дърво с дължина 1,5 инча

75 фута 20awg твърда жица

Ардуино Леонардо (1)

10k Ohm потенциометър (3)

Ротационен енкодер AMT103 (1)

BTS7960 43a Контролер на двигателя (1)

12v 30a Захранване (1)

Стандартни крайни превключватели (7)

VEX Robotics 2.5in CIM мотор

VEX Robotics CIMple Gearbox 4.61: 1

1/2 в ключ с ключ с andymark.com (продукт #am-0077a) (1)

3D принтер и нишки (ABS и TPU)

конектори xt60 и xt90

Термосвиваеми тръби

Волан с 6x70 мм монтажен модел

Опционално бързо освобождаване на волана

Седалка и плъзгачи на кофата

По избор 4pt колани

Стъпка 1: Изграждане на рамка

Изграждане на рамка
Изграждане на рамка
Изграждане на рамка
Изграждане на рамка
Изграждане на рамка
Изграждане на рамка
Изграждане на рамка
Изграждане на рамка

Размерите на рамките са много течни и зависят от няколко различни фактора. Нещата, които трябва да имате предвид, са седалката, която сте избрали да изградите около основната рамка, размерът на потребителя, за да определите разстоянието на педала, където ще бъде поставен сим, тъй като след сглобяването му не е лесно да се движи и разбира се стила на колата и усещането, което търсите. След като сте разработили всички тези подробности, процесът на изграждане е много подобен при различните симове. Започнете с изграждането на правоъгълника, в който ще седи седалката. Обърнете внимание, че воланът е монтиран в предната част на правоъгълника на седалката, а също така се уверете, че има достатъчно място за седалката да се плъзне през целия си обхват на движение, за да осигури регулируемост. След това изрежете правоъгълник от 3/4 -инчов MDF, широк колкото правоъгълника на PVC седалката, и толкова дълъг, колкото монтажните отвори за плъзгачите на вашите седалки. Оттам можете да закрепите седалката си и да започнете да измервате колко висок трябва да бъде воланът, както и колко дълга трябва да бъде рамката на педала. Използването на триъгълна конструкция за свързване на края на стойката на педала към горната част на стойката на волана помага значително за втвърдяване на рамката. Ако решите да инсталирате колани, можете просто да монтирате болтове на краищата на сбруята към релсите на седалките през отворите им за болтове. Въпреки че това не би било безопасно в действителна кола, това е повече от достатъчна твърдост за симулатор. Снимките по -горе могат да ви помогнат да разберете дизайна на рамката и да планирате рамката си. Не влязох в конструкцията с никакви твърди размери, тъй като нещата започват да се променят, когато седнете на седалката и се опитате да я направите удобна и използваема. След като рамката ви бъде сглобена, уверете се, че всяка фуга е сигурна, като дадете на всеки монтаж веднъж с гумен чук. След това можете да пробиете пилотни отвори през всяка PVC връзка и да инсталирате винт от ламарина #10, за да държите PVC заедно. За повечето съединения е достатъчен един винт, въпреки че на вертикалната стойка на волана може да се наложи да инсталирате повече. След като рамката ви е заедно, можете да започнете инсталирането на електроника.

Стъпка 2: Електроника

Електроника
Електроника
Електроника
Електроника
Електроника
Електроника

Инсталирането на енкодера е много просто, тъй като отворът на енкодера е 1/2 инча и пасва идеално на вала на скоростната кутия. Енкодерът с интерфейс с arduino Leonardo за да каже на компютъра къде е обърнат воланът. След това следвайте електрическата схема, за да направите всички необходими връзки. Можете или директно да запоявате към arduino, или да използвате заглавки за щифтове. Избрах да запоя, за да се уверя, че никакви връзки случайно не се развалят. След това трябва да изберете корпус за вашето захранване, контролер на двигателя и arduino. Избрах да използвам кутия за боеприпаси, тъй като те са евтини и лесно достъпни и много издръжливи. Пробих дупки отстрани и поставих гумени уплътнения, за да предпазя кабелите от остри ръбове. След това извадих всички връзки от arduino и извадих втулката с плетена найлонова кабелна втулка. Също така инсталирах конектори xt60 и xt90 около 6 инча след втулката, за да улесня подмяната и бъдещите надстройки. След като свършите всички проводници, можете да монтирате своя двигател с обратна връзка за сила към стойката на волана. За да прикрепите волана към главината на двигателя, ще трябва да отпечатате 3D адаптер. Файлът Solidworks за адаптерната кутия е свързан. Превключвателят не беше мой дизайн, след няколко неуспешни опита реших да използвам популярен дизайн на Thingiverse. Това може да бъде намерено с бързо търсене и разполага с цялата документация, необходима за сглобяване, така че няма да се притеснявам да го прегледам тук. За да монтирате превключвателя, ще ви трябват файловете за монтиране на Shifter и Shifter Strap. Монтажът трябва да бъде отпечатан на ABS, докато каишката трябва да бъде отпечатана от гъвкав TPU. Тази стойка ви позволява бързо да регулирате превключвателя и дори да сменяте страни за автомобили с LHD и RHD. Към момента съм завършил до този момент. Следващите стъпки са сглобяването на багажника на педалите и кутията. Това ще се случи скоро и инструкциите ще бъдат актуализирани, за да отразят моя напредък. Има страхотни примери за DIY сим педали в YouTube, които могат да бъдат адаптирани за работа с този проект лесно, но реших да изградя педала в изцяло от алуминий, за да увелича реалистичния аспект.

Стъпка 3: Следващи стъпки

Следващи стъпки
Следващи стъпки

След завършване на монтажа на педала, окабеляването може да бъде финализирано и след това симулаторът е готов за употреба. Не забравяйте, че този симулатор не е проектиран да се използва с настройка на монитор, така че няма помещения за монтиране на екрани. Избрах този маршрут, защото добър набор от VR очила са много по -евтини от традиционната настройка с тройни монитори и вярвам, че реализмът да можеш да огледаш вътрешността на колата в игри като Assetto Corsa или Project Cars 2 носи изцяло ново измерение на опита на симулатора.

Препоръчано: